- Description
- Rectangular brass plaque
- Inscription
- IN LOVING MEMORY OF/ EDWARD HAROLD CLAYTON/ 2ND LIEUTENANT ROYAL AIR FORCE/ SEVERLEY WOUNDED AUG 11TH, DIED AUG 21ST, 1918/ - HIS 20TH BIRTHDAY -/ BURIED AT VALENCIENNES R.I.P.
